Located at the entrance of Sultanahmet Square, the German Fountain immediately captivates visitors with its elegant architecture and intriguing history. Gifted by German Emperor Wilhelm II in 1901 to commemorate his visit to Istanbul, this octagonal structure features a striking neo-Byzantine design and a dome decorated with shimmering golden mosaics. Offering a peaceful corner amid the lively square, the fountain stands as a symbol of friendship between the Ottoman Empire and Germany.

The Hippodrome invites travelers to step into the grandeur of ancient Constantinople, once the beating heart of social and sporting life in the Byzantine Empire. This vast square, where thousands once gathered to watch thrilling chariot races, now hosts remarkable monuments such as the Serpent Column, the Obelisk of Theodosius, and the Walled Obelisk. As visitors stroll through the area, they can almost hear the echoes of cheering crowds and feel the pulse of centuries-old imperial ceremonies.

A masterpiece that has shaped the soul of Istanbul for over 1,400 years, Hagia Sophia stands as a testament to the city's layered heritage. Built in 537 as the grand basilica of the Byzantine Empire, its immense dome, intricate mosaics, and ingenious engineering continue to inspire awe. Having served as a church, a mosque, and a museum over the centuries, Hagia Sophia embodies the rich cultural fusion of civilizations. Excavations here have revealed artifacts dating from 3500 BC (Late Chalcolithic) to 3000 BC (Early Bronze Age). The city’s name comes from the Seleucid king Antiochus ii, who named it for his wife Laodike in the 3rd century BC when it was thriving. Later controlled by the kings of Pergamum, it was willed to the Roman Empire, and thrived again from the 4th to 6th centuries. Its importance then numbered it among the Seven Churches of Revelation.

The next visit of your tour will be the last home of the Virgin Mary. Once you arrive there you will be thrilled by the natural beauty that surrounds the monument. The House of Virgin Mary is located on the Aladag Mountains 5 miles away from Ephesus. At the third Ecumenical Council on 431 AD in Ephesus, it was claimed that Mary came to Ephesus with St. John in 37 A.D. and lived there until her death in 48 A.D. After the discovery of the house, the Archbishop of Izmir declared there as a place of pilgrimage in 1892. On July 26, 1967, Pope Paul VI visited this place and prayed there.

Keslik Monastery is a sprawling cave monastery complex with two churches, a large refectory hall, a sacred spring, and endless cave rooms. Located in an idyllic garden setting, this is the most expansive monastery in Cappadocia. This site has been used and developed in many ways throughout the course of 2,000 years. This area was a gravesite in pre-Christian Roman times, a large communal monastery during the Byzantine era, and now a tourist site in modern Turkey.

Kaymakli, one of the major underground cities of Cappadocia, consists of 8 floors. However, as in many underground cities, not all floors are open to tourists. In the city, the first floor is separated for the animals to go out easily. Establish a connection between the churches and other living spaces with the corridors separated from the stables. Kaymakli Underground City, which has astounding sections such as warehouses, kitchens, cemeteries, mughouse, and copper processing workshop, still contains hidden underground tunnels that have not been fully revealed.

The Goreme Open-Air Museum features an extensive monastic complex carved directly into the soft volcanic rock, including ancient churches, kitchens, wineries, storerooms, and living spaces once inhabited by Anatolian Christians. With its unique architectural details and beautifully preserved frescoes, the site offers a vivid window into early Christian life in Cappadocia. Its cultural and historical significance has earned it a place on the UNESCO World Heritage List.

The Tokalı Church (Buckle Church) in the Göreme Open Air Museum is considered one of the most beautiful of the Cappadocian cave churches. Its interior boasts some of the most outstanding frescoes, notable for their theological and artistic significance. The church is part of a larger complex that includes four churches and a hermitage, all dating back to the 9th century. Once the most famous church in the region, it remains one of the most impressive churches in the area today.

The old city of Avanos, whose name in ancient times was Venessa, overlooks the longest river of Turkey, the Kizilirmak (Red River), which also separates Avanos from the rest of Cappadocia. The most famous historical feature of Avanos, which is still relevant and very visible today, is its production of earthenware pottery; it is also the most economic activity in the town. The ceramic trade in this district and its countless pottery factories date right back to the Hittites, and the ceramic clay from the red silt of the Kizilirmak has always been used.
